WebJava Characters Characters are considered among the essential data type in every programming language. For Java also, basic text-based computations are done using 'char' data type which is the primary data type for Java. Example: char[] chArr ={ 'k', 'a', 'r', 'l', 'o', 's' }; Character Wrapper Class WebApr 4, 2024 · Character.forDigit () to Convert int to char in Java. toString () Method to Convert Int to Char in Java. In this tutorial, we will learn methods to convert int to a char …
Java - Character forDigit() Method - tutorialspoint.com
Webpublic static String bytesToHex (byte [] data, int len) { char [] hex = new char[len * 2]; for (int i = 0; i < len; i++) { int di = data[i]; hex[i << 1] = Character. forDigit ((di >> 4) & 15, 16); … Web2. Convert int to char using Integer.charValue () method. Character.forDigit () is a static method of Character class that returns a char value for the character determined by the digit (first argument) and radix (second argument). In this example, we shall use Character.forDigit () method to get the representation of the digit in the given radix. the understanding the self
Java Program - Convert Int to Char - TutorialKart
WebJan 13, 2014 · In Java we can do this all in one shot: Character.forDigit ( (bytes [0] >> 4) & 0xF, 16); The forDigit function just maps the number you pass it onto the set of hexadecimal numbers 0-F. Step 3: Next we need to isolate the lower order bits. Since the bits we want are already in the correct position, we can just mask them out: WebThe forDigit(int digit, int radix) method of character class determines the character representation for a specific digit in the specified radix. If the value of the digit is not a valid digit in the specified radix or if the value of the radix is not a valid radix then a null … WebMay 23, 2024 · 2.1. Byte to Hexadecimal. The bytes are 8 bit signed integers in Java. Therefore, we need to convert each 4-bit segment to hex separately and concatenate them. Consequently, we'll get two hexadecimal characters after conversion. For instance, we can write 45 as 0010 1101 in binary, and the hexadecimal equivalent will be “2d”: 0010 = 2 … the underside of the foot